Climate change, education, and changing socio-economic factors have contributed to Indian girls reaching puberty earlier, according to a new study. Researchers linked increased humidity to earlier menarche—while high temperatures were associated with delayed onset. Social factors were also significant, though disparities by religion, ethnicity, and region were found to have narrowed.
